How to display LEGO Speed Champions F1 cars (77252–77257) – a UK collector’s setup

How to display LEGO Speed Champions F1 cars (77252–77257)

If you’re wondering how to display LEGO Speed Champions F1 cars so they look intentional, think in terms of presentation rather than storage.

A solid “collector setup” usually nails three things:

1) A consistent look across the series
These F1 builds look best when they feel like a set — the same frame style, the same visual language, a clean background. When each car is displayed differently, the collection feels messy even if your shelf is tidy.

2) The right viewing angle
F1 shapes are all about aero surfaces — wings, sidepods, engine cover lines. A display that presents the car at a strong angle (rather than flat on a shelf) makes those details pop immediately.

3) Protection you don’t have to think about
Dust is annoying, but it’s also work: the more you handle a Speed Champions car, the more likely you are to knock something loose. A protective frame keeps the model looking fresh without constant touch-ups.

If your end goal is a “mini gallery wall” of the full 77252–77257 run, you’re already thinking like a collector — and the display should match that energy.

Wall mounted LEGO F1 display vs shelf display – what’s better for UK homes?

Wall mounted LEGO F1 display vs shelf display

For most UK collectors, space is the deciding factor. Not everyone has dedicated display cabinets — but almost everyone has a wall that can work harder.

Wall-mounted display: the best “gallery” effect

A wall mounted LEGO F1 display instantly elevates the collection. It keeps the cars away from clutter, gives them a clean viewing angle, and turns a set of small builds into something that looks like motorsport art.

Wall mounting is also brilliant for:

  • flats where shelf space is limited

  • homes with pets or small children

  • anyone who wants their display to look deliberate and tidy

This is why speed champions wall display layouts are so popular: they look premium and save space.

Shelf / desk display: flexible and easy to move

A desk or shelf setup makes sense if you like changing the layout or moving builds between rooms. It’s also great for a single hero car on a home office shelf.

How to protect LEGO F1 cars from dust & UV damage (acrylic display tips)

Protection isn’t just about keeping things neat — it’s about keeping your build looking new.

Dust is the slow fade of a great display

Speed Champions cars have small crevices and lots of texture. Dust dulls the finish and makes colours look flat. The fix is either constant cleaning (more handling) or a display that reduces exposure.

Light can be harsh over time

In many UK homes, the natural place to display models is near windows or under spotlights. Over time, light exposure can make displays look tired. A framed setup helps because you can position it more deliberately and reduce direct exposure.

Why acrylic displays work well

A LEGO speed champions acrylic display UK setup is easier to maintain:

  • quick wipe-clean surfaces

  • less dust settling on the model

  • backgrounds that keep the display looking sharp even after months on the wall
